i need fast weight loss help

alright here's the deal...i'm leaving for the beach in about 3 weeks then after that i am going straight to college and i would LOVE to shed some pounds before i go. So what would be the best way to lose as much weight as possible in the next 3 weeks? i would try one of those silly one week fad diets but i know thats not gonna work so please help me out. I'm 18 about 5'4" and 150 lbs. Any advice would be great! thanks ya'll!

Well theres no way to loose alot of weight fast and keep it off. fad diets and pills dont work for long term weight loss. Eating a healthy well balanced diet and cardio is the key to weight loss and keeping it off. a safe target is 2lbs a week(usually a little more in the 1st week)
add more protein to your diet cut back on the white(bread,flour, sugar ect) and processed stuff.add lots of veggies, fruits and whole grains.
try to add some resistance training it helps add muscle that burns more cals.
drink some water 2-3L, cut out fruit juices,soda,juices (like kool-aid) and sports type drinks also cut out the take out, snack foods, sweets....
good luck, any questions just ask
